Male, ~3 years old, ~40 lbs. Approximate Age: ~3 years old   Approximate Weight/Size: Medium   Good with: Dogs   Not tested with: Cats, Kids   Hi, I'm Acorn! I am a gorgeous, polite, and gentle dog who loves to run. I am very gentle and shy, but when I'm around other dogs I perk right up and can play for hours. I can be nervous when I meet new people and definitely prefer the great outdoors to being cooped up inside. A quiet neighborhood with a yard would be best since many sounds from the city still scare me. I really love other pups and I will do best in a home with another confident pup who can show me the ropes and help me build my confidence within the house. I also need an experienced and patient family who will give me time to come out of my shell. I respond well to affection and I will reward my new family with the sweetest personality on the planet. Even though I'm still learning how to heel, sit, etc. I really love going on walks and it's great for my mental health. I have been described as "clean, quiet, not destructive, with a perfect energy level." Male, ~12 months old, ~56 lbs. Approximate Age: ~12 months old   Approximate Weight/Size: Medium   Good with: Dogs, Cats, Kids   Hi, I'm Brownie! I'm a sweet pup who loves meeting new people and playing with other dogs at the dog park. I am outgoing and lovable and I enjoy getting ample exercise and sniffs around the neighborhood. Once I've had my walks and some time at the dog park, I'm a total cuddle bug. I am also super smart and easily trainable. I like car rides but I can get a little startled with loud city noises. I love to run so the dog park is one of my favorite places. I would even make a great running partner! I could use some leash training before that, however. I am crate trained and enjoy eating, sleeping, chewing toys, and generally hanging out in there. I am a try hound -- always sniffing around the ground and even sometimes, unauthorized, on the counter. Geneva is a 7 year old, 65lb treeing walker coonhound.  She has overcome much to get where she is and is ready for a forever home!  She's a cuddle bug who loves to crawl into bed with you and play around with other dogs like she's a puppy.  She does get the zoomies at home but some ball throws or a Himalayan cheese stick and she starts to settle down.  She is good with kids but not with cats as all she wants to do is chase them and play which can be a difficult situation for them.  She does need some work on command training but she is a quick learner!   PAW places animals in the Washington, DC/Baltimore Metropolitan area only. ##1147393##
